Subject: Re: [PATCH] arm64: dts: qcom: sm8450: fix interconnects property of UFS node
Date: Tue, 5 Apr 2022 10:19:49 -0700 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<Ykx6NWrcf4IA2Mam@ripper>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<dbe6d9c5-f717-785f-e65d-baa1328cea2b@linaro.org>
On Tue 05 Apr 08:38 PDT 2022, Dmitry Baryshkov wrote:
> On 11/03/2022 01:19, Vladimir Zapolskiy wrote:
> > All interconnect device tree nodes on sm8450 are 2-cells, however in
> > UFS node they are handled as 1-cells, fix it.
> >
> > Fixes: aa2d0bf04a3c ("arm64: dts: qcom: sm8450: add interconnect nodes")
> > Signed-off-by: Vladimir Zapolskiy <vladimir.zapolskiy@linaro.org>
>
> Reviewed-by: Dmitry Baryshkov <dmitry.baryshkov@linaro.org>
>
> Bjorn, could you please this pick for the -rc kernel?
>
The change is obviously correct, but what difference does this change
make with the current implementation?
Regards,
Bjorn
> > ---
> > arch/arm64/boot/dts/qcom/sm8450.dtsi | 4 ++--
> > 1 file changed, 2 insertions(+), 2 deletions(-)
> >
> > diff --git a/arch/arm64/boot/dts/qcom/sm8450.dtsi b/arch/arm64/boot/dts/qcom/sm8450.dtsi
> > index 0cd5af8c03bd..bbd38b55e976 100644
> > --- a/arch/arm64/boot/dts/qcom/sm8450.dtsi
> > +++ b/arch/arm64/boot/dts/qcom/sm8450.dtsi
> > @@ -1376,8 +1376,8 @@ ufs_mem_hc: ufshc@1d84000 {
> > iommus = <&apps_smmu 0xe0 0x0>;
> > - interconnects = <&aggre1_noc MASTER_UFS_MEM &mc_virt SLAVE_EBI1>,
> > - <&gem_noc MASTER_APPSS_PROC &config_noc SLAVE_UFS_MEM_CFG>;
> > + interconnects = <&aggre1_noc MASTER_UFS_MEM 0 &mc_virt SLAVE_EBI1 0>,
> > + <&gem_noc MASTER_APPSS_PROC 0 &config_noc SLAVE_UFS_MEM_CFG 0>;
> > interconnect-names = "ufs-ddr", "cpu-ufs";
